Nitrous Activation Question

I was thinking the other day on your guys' nitrous set-ups, the button you push to spray it is one of those switches that stays on till you push it again correct? so when you hit it it stays on? then when you get to the end of the track the WOT switch kicks off the nitrous when you let off the gas? Or are some of you using buttons you hold down and let off when you don't want it.

Re: Nitrous Activation Question

To my knowledge, most anyone using a "button" that they press is using one that they have to hold to keep the nitrous spraying, not one that they press once to start it, then again to shut it off.

Re: Nitrous Activation Question

I use a pushbutton and it is momentary. if I don't keep it depressed the nitrous will turn off.

Now I also have a window switch, microswitch and main nitrous arm, but if the button is not held it, it will not spray.
